34 providers in Allergy And Immunology, Ophthalmology (eye Disorders), Senior Psychiatry (geriatrics), Surgical Oncology

34 providers in Allergy And Immunology, Ophthalmology (eye Disorders), Senior Psychiatry (geriatrics), Surgical Oncology